Helen Foster Snow, wife of Edgar Snow and author of Inside Red China, followed the footsteps of her husband to northwestern China in 1937. There she interviewed Communist army leaders as well as average soldiers, women and children, leaving behind a treasure trove of interview notes, pictures and writings. In a recent event held at the Cedar City, Utah, where Helen was born in 1907, she's fondly remembered by friends and family from the United States and China.
